Microscope Parts & Functions - AmScope Microscope Parts and Functions Invented by a Dutch spectacle maker in the late 16th century, compound light microscopes use two sets of lenses to magnify images for study and observation. The first set of lenses are the oculars, or eyepieces, that the viewer looks into; the second set of lenses are the objectives, which are closest to the specimen. Compound Microscope Parts - Labeled Diagram and their Functions Basically, compound microscopes generate magnified images through an aligned pair of the objective lens and the ocular lens. In contrast, "simple microscopes" have only one convex lens and function more like glass magnifiers. [In this figure] Two "antique" microscopes played significant roles in the history of biology.

Stereo microscopes (also called Dissecting microscope) are branched out from other light microscopes for the application of viewing "3D" objects. These include substantial specimens, such as insects, feathers, leaves, rocks, sand grains, gems, coins, and stamps, etc. Functionally, a stereo microscope is like a powerful magnifying glass.

Simple Microscope - Parts, Functions, Diagram and Labelling Mirror - A simple microscope has a plano-convex mirror and its primary function is to focus the surrounding light on the object being examined. Lens - The biconvex lens is placed above the stage and its function is to magnify the size of the object being examined.

The functioning of the light microscope is based on its ability to focus a beam of light through a specimen, which is very small and transparent, to produce an image. The image is then passed through one or two lenses for magnification for viewing. The transparency of the specimen allows easy and quick penetration of light.
